Synopsis:

In The Incredible Hulk, Bruce Banner is on the run, trying to find a cure for the gamma radiation that turns him into the Hulk. As he hides from the military, led by General Ross, Bruce works to control his transformations. Meanwhile, Ross recruits Emil Blonsky, a soldier who becomes obsessed with capturing the Hulk. Blonsky undergoes a dangerous procedure to gain similar powers, transforming into the Abomination. The story follows Bruce's struggle to stay hidden, his attempts to reunite with his love interest, Betty Ross, and the inevitable showdown between the Hulk and the Abomination. The movie is packed with action as Bruce battles both his inner demons and external threats.

What Parents Should Know About The Incredible Hulk

Question Answer
Does this movie explore topics that require emotional maturity or guidance? The film explores themes of anger management and the consequences of unchecked power, depicted through Bruce Banner's struggle with his alter ego.
Does this movie portray risky behaviors that go unchecked or without consequences? There are scenes of destruction and violence that are not always critically addressed, though the consequences are shown through the impact on Banner's life.
Does the main character show growth or learning across the story? Bruce Banner learns to better control his emotions and use his abilities for positive outcomes, as seen in his efforts to protect others.
Are gender roles, relationships, or family dynamics portrayed in thoughtful or outdated ways? The film portrays a supportive relationship between Bruce and Betty, highlighting mutual respect and understanding.
Will this movie prompt important conversations with my teen? The film can lead to discussions about managing emotions and the responsibilities that come with power.
